Identify Your Needs
The first step in choosing the right option is to clearly identify what you need. This involves understanding your priorities, preferences, and the context in which you will be using the selected option. Ask yourself the following questions:
- What are my main goals with this choice?
- What are the functionalities or features that matter most to me?
- Are there specific limitations or requirements I need to consider?
By answering these questions, you set a solid foundation for your decision. A clear understanding of your needs will help narrow down the choices available to you.
Research Options
Once you have identified your needs, the next step is to research different options available in the market. Utilize multiple resources to gather as much information as possible:
- Online Reviews: Look for customer feedback and expert reviews. Websites, forums, and social media platforms are rich resources for real-life experiences.
- Comparisons: Use comparison websites to evaluate different products or services side by side based on features, price, and user ratings.
- Ask Others: Consult friends, family, or colleagues who might have experience with the options you’re considering.
In-depth research helps you understand the pros and cons of each option, enabling you to make a more informed choice.
Set a Budget
Your budget can significantly influence your decision. Determine how much you are willing to spend and adhere to this budget. Consider the following:
- Are you looking for a generous investment, or do you prefer something more affordable?
- Will you need to consider ongoing costs such as maintenance, subscriptions, or upgrades?
Creating a clear financial framework for your choice will help eliminate options that are beyond your means and focus on what fits comfortably within your budget.
Evaluate Features and Benefits
Now that you have narrowed down your research based on needs and budget, analyze the features and benefits of each option:
- Features: List the key features of each option. It’s helpful to prioritize which features are essential versus those that are merely nice to have.
- Benefits: Assess how each choice aligns with your priorities and goals. Understand how each feature translates into real-world utility or satisfaction.
A comprehensive evaluation ensures that you are not just lured by attractive marketing but also by genuine value.
Consider the Brand Reputation
The reputation of a brand can often serve as a reflection of quality and reliability. Research the history of the brands you are considering. Factors to weigh include:
- How long has the brand been in the market?
- What is the brand’s standing among consumers in your demographic?
- Is customer support responsive and helpful?
A reputable brand may provide peace of mind, particularly when it comes to warranty, service, and overall customer satisfaction.
Try Before You Buy
If possible, try before you buy. This is particularly relevant for products. Many retail stores offer demos or sample products. Likewise, many services provide trials. Take advantage of this to ensure that the option you choose feels right:
- Visit a store to test the product physically.
- Check for a free trial period for services.
Testing items first-hand can often illuminate aspects that may not be immediately clear through research alone.
Make Your Decision
After careful evaluation, it’s time to make your choice. Remember to trust your instincts alongside the researched data. Sometimes, intuition can also play a crucial role in decision-making.
After deciding, ensure that you keep all information about your purchase such as receipts, warranties, and terms for returns or exchanges. This will be valuable if you have questions or concerns after making your purchase.
